How they compare

Latvia currently reports 6,209 1000 USD against 4,368 1000 USD in Egypt, a difference of 1,841 1000 USD.

That makes Latvia's figure about 1.4 times Egypt's.

The two have swapped places 7 times across 27 shared years of data; in 1998 it was Egypt ahead.

Egypt ranks 44th and Latvia ranks 43rd of 175 countries.

Across the 4 decades both report, Egypt averaged higher in 3 and Latvia in 1.

Head to head by decade

Decade Egypt Latvia Difference Ahead
1990s 53 1000 USD 319 1000 USD 266 1000 USD Latvia
2000s 10,724 1000 USD 6,514 1000 USD 4,210 1000 USD Egypt
2010s 12,629 1000 USD 8,657 1000 USD 3,972 1000 USD Egypt
2020s 7,783 1000 USD 7,595 1000 USD 187.4 1000 USD Egypt

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
